THE Commissioner General of the Tanzania Revenue Authority (TRA), Mr. Yusuph Juma Mwenda, has expressed sympathy to taxpayers, TRA staff, and all Tanzanians affected by the recent challenges that occurred during the October 29, 2025 general election.
During his visit to the Ilala and Kariakoo tax regions, Mr. Mwenda met with taxpayers and TRA employees, assuring them that TRA remains committed to delivering quality services, listening to taxpayers, and solving their concerns.
He urged TRA staff to continue working with professionalism, efficiency, and accountability despite damages and disruptions faced in some offices, emphasizing that taxpayers and their businesses are the authority’s top priority.
Mr. Mwenda also confirmed that TRA services are continuing as normal in all affected areas and thanked taxpayers like Mr. Salim Virani of Kariakoo, who expressed satisfaction with TRA’s ongoing support and services.
